What is the age 0 in Pokemon go?

Age (in Days): Search age plus a number to see how many days ago you caught a particular Pokémon. For example, age0 will show Pokémon you caught within the last 24 hours and age1 will show Pokémon you caught 24 to 48 hours ago.

Does Pokémon GO track you?

Like most GPS apps, Pokémon Go tracks all data related to your movement. Unlike apps such as Foursquare and Tinder, Pokémon Go may collect — among other things — your email address, IP address, the web page you were using before logging into Pokémon Go, your username and your location.

Is it better to purify or not Pokemon Go?

Purified Pokemon will have better Appraisal and receive 2 points towards all their IVs. This can potentially bring a 2-star Shadow Pokemon to a 3-star if it's purified. Purified Pokemon will receive a significant boost in Combat Power (CP).

Is Pokémon Go a violent game?

Official age rating

The PEGI 7 rating reflects the mild cartoon-like violence between Pokémon characters within the game. It is not a game with realistic violence or adult themed content. In the Apple App Store and Google Play store, the game is rated as 9+.
